NEW QUESTION # 57
A telecommunications company implements branch versioning for their organization. The default version is the published version that portal users see and editors can post edits to.
Which version access level should be set?
- A. Public
- B. Private
- C. Protected
Answer: C
Explanation:
In a branch versioning workflow where thedefault versionis the published version that users see and editors can post edits to, setting the access level toProtectedis the best choice.
1. What Does the Protected Access Level Do?
* TheProtectedaccess level allows users to view and query the version but restricts editing to authorized users only.
* This ensures that only authorized editors can post changes to the default version, maintaining data integrity while allowing portal users to access the published version.
2. Why Not Other Options?
* Public:
* A public version allows anyone with appropriate permissions to edit the version. This could lead to uncontrolled changes and data integrity issues.
* Private:
* A private version restricts access to the version to only the owner and specific users, which is unsuitable when the default version is meant to be the published version visible to all portal users.
Steps to Configure Protected Access Level:
* OpenArcGIS ProorArcGIS Enterprise Manager.
* Navigate to the version management settings for the default version.
* Set theAccess LeveltoProtected.
* Ensure that editors with appropriate privileges are assigned to post changes to the default version.

NEW QUESTION # 58
An organization has an enterprise geodatabase used for editing and public use. Editors are experiencing performance issues during peak hours. The GIS data administrator needs to make sure that the editing and public usage do not affect each other.
Which action should be taken?
- A. Build new feature datasets
- B. Create separate database instances
- C. Separate permissions for public services
Answer: B
Explanation:
To ensure that editing and public usage do not affect each other, the best approach is tocreate separate database instancesfor these purposes.
1. Why Separate Database Instances?
* Performance Isolation: Separating the databases ensures that editing operations (which are resource- intensive) do not impact the performance of queries or map services used by the public.
* Workload Management: Editors can work in a dedicated environment with optimized settings for editing, while the public-facing database can focus on efficient querying and read-only access.
* Security and Data Integrity: Public users are isolated from the editing environment, reducing the risk of unauthorized changes or accidental data loss.
2. How Separate Instances Work
* Primary (Editing) Database: This instance supports editing workflows, including versioning, replication, and real-time updates.
* Replica (Public) Database: A replicated copy of the primary database is maintained for public usage.
Updates can be synchronized periodically using one-way or two-way replication.
3. Why Not Other Options?
* Build New Feature Datasets:
* Feature datasets organize related feature classes but do not separate editing and querying workloads. Performance issues would persist.
* Separate Permissions for Public Services:
* While restricting permissions helps secure data, it does not address performance issues caused by concurrent editing and public queries on the same database instance.
Steps to Create Separate Instances:
* Set up aprimary database instancefor editing workflows.
* Create areplica database instancefor public use by:
* Using one-way replication to push updates from the primary to the public database.
* Configuring the replica as read-only for public access.
* Monitor and optimize each instance independently to ensure optimal performance.

NEW QUESTION # 59
The GIS administrator does not have the database administrator credentials and needs to create an enterprise geodatabase for storage of vector data. The database administrator will provide a database with the appropriate users and permissions for use.
Which tool should the GIS administrator use?
- A. Create Enterprise Geodatabase
- B. Enable Enterprise Geodatabase
- C. Create Feature Dataset
Answer: B
Explanation:
Understanding the Scenario:The GIS administrator lacks database administrator credentials but requires an enterprise geodatabase for vector data storage. In this setup, the database administrator (DBA) is responsible for preparing the database, including setting up users and permissions, while the GIS administrator is tasked with enabling it as an enterprise geodatabase.
Tool Selection Overview:
* Create Feature Dataset:This tool is for creating a logical grouping of related feature classes inside an existing geodatabase. It is unrelated to enabling or creating an enterprise geodatabase.
* Enable Enterprise Geodatabase:This tool is used when a database has already been created and configured by the DBA, and the GIS administrator needs to enable it as an enterprise geodatabase. It adds geodatabase system tables and functionality to the database. This aligns with the scenario described.
* Create Enterprise Geodatabase:This tool creates a new database and configures it as an enterprise geodatabase in one step.However, this tool requires database administrator credentials, which the GIS administrator in this scenario does not have.
Key Steps to Enable an Enterprise Geodatabase:
* Preparation by DBA:The DBA sets up the database, ensuring the appropriate users and permissions are in place. They also provide connection details to the GIS administrator.
* Using the Enable Enterprise Geodatabase Tool:
* Navigate toArcGIS ProorArcGIS Enterprise tools.
* Open theEnable Enterprise Geodatabasetool.
* Specify the database connection file for the target database.
* Provide the authorization file (a valid ArcGIS Server Enterprise license file) to enable geodatabase functionality.
* Execute the tool to add system tables, stored procedures, and geodatabase functionality to the database.

NEW QUESTION # 61
A GIS administrator needs to make a synchronized copy of a branch versioned dataset. Editing must be performed on both copies.
How should the data be replicated?
- A. Geodatabase replication
- B. Distributed collaboration
- C. DBMS replication
Answer: A
Explanation:
Scenario Overview:
* The GIS administrator needs to create asynchronized copyof a branch versioned dataset.
* Both copies must allowediting.
Why Geodatabase Replication?
* Geodatabase replicationsupports the creation of synchronized copies of datasets while allowing edits in both the parent and child geodatabases.
* Forbranch versioned data, replication ensures that edits made in either the parent or child geodatabase can be synchronized using a two-way replica.(ArcGIS Documentation: Geodatabase Replication) Key Features of Geodatabase Replication for This Scenario:
* Two-way replicationenables editing on both sides while synchronizing changes.
* Supportsbranch versioning, ensuring versioned workflows remain intact.
* Maintains schema consistency across both geodatabases.
Alternative Options:
* Option A: Distributed Collaboration
* Collaboration is suitable for sharing data across ArcGIS Enterprise environments but does not support active synchronization for editing on both sides.
* Option C: DBMS Replication
* DBMS-level replication handles raw data replication but does not preserve geodatabase-specific functionalities, such as branch versioning.
Thus,geodatabase replicationis the correct method for synchronizing and editing branch versioned datasets in both geodatabases.
